Stability indicator
(Amplifier)

The indicator will be lit in green when the object is within the measurement range and the receiver receives
light intense enough to be reflected from the object. When the indicator is green, the Sensor’s measuring
operation is stable.

If the indicator is not lit in green while the sensitivity selector is set to WHITE; set it to BLACK or AUTO for a
more stable measuring operation. Normal output can be obtained even if the indicator is not lit in green.

The indicator will be lit in red when there is no object in front of the Sensor or if the light reflected from the
object is either insufficient or too intense. If the indicator is red, check if the sensitivity selector is set correctly
(according to the reflection ratio of the object).

Sensitivity selector
(Amplifier)

Set the sensitivity selector according to the reflection ratio of the object.

If the color of the object is white, set it to WHITE.

If the color of the object is black, set it to BLACK.

If the color of the object is not white or black, set it to AUTO.

When the sensitivity selector is set to AUTO, the enable output may be ON even if the object is outside the
measurement range, in which case set the sensitivity selector to WHITE so that the number of errors that may
occur can be minimized.

Response speed
selector (Amplifier)

Select the response speed by taking the required response speed and resolution into consideration.

Response speed Fast:

Resolution Low

Response speed Slow:

Resolution High

Offset adjuster
(Amplifier)

Offset adjustment is possible at any position within the measurement range since the output will be 0 V.

The output voltage must be within

±

5 V, or the linearity of the output cannot be guaranteed.

The output is adjusted before shipping, so that it will be approximately 0 V when the object is in the middle of
the measurement range.
